Legal Issues
- 1 Whether the High Court at Mombasa is the proper forum to hear the application regarding the release of documents impounded by police in Nyeri.
- 2 Whether the application should have been filed before the Resident Judge at Nyeri.
Ratio Decidendi
The court determined that the application for the release of documents, which are held by police officers in Nyeri and relate to property within the jurisdiction of the High Court at Nyeri, should have been filed before the Resident Judge at Nyeri. The Mombasa High Court thus directs that the ruling be transmitted to the Resident Judge, Nyeri, for appropriate handling and further directions, as the proper forum for the application is Nyeri, not Mombasa.
Court Disposition
Application to be mentioned before the Resident Judge, Nyeri, for further directions; ruling to be transmitted accordingly.
Orders
- Ruling to be typed, certified, and sent to the Resident Judge, Nyeri, immediately.
- Application to be mentioned before the Resident Judge, Nyeri, on 7th June 2001 at 9:30 a.m. for further directions.

REPUBLIC OF KENYA
IN THE HIGH COURT OF KENYA AT MOMBASA APPELLATE SIDE CRIMINAL APPEAL NO.473 OF 1999
(From Original Conviction and Sentence in Criminal Case No.4075 of 1999 of the Chief Magistrate’s Court at Mombasa –L. Achode, Mrs. –S.R.M.)
MUTHII CHOMBA ……………………………………. APPLICANT
VERSUS
REPUBLIC …………………………………………..RESPONDENT
RULING
Plot No.135 Kerugoya Kutus Municipality is the suit Property and is situated within the immediate area falling within the High Court Nyeri. Indeed Mr. Kiama has informed me that this suit is fixed for hearing before the Resident Judge Nyeri on the 12th June 2001. The Police Officers who are alleged to have arrested the applicant and impounded his documents are based at the CID Offices in Nyeri. Documents sought to be released are said to be kept in these Offices at Nyeri. I agree with Mr Okello State Counsel that this application ought to have been filed and fixed for disposal before the Resident Judge, Nyeri.
I therefore direct that this be typed and certified and ruling be sent to the Resident Judge immediately so that the same be placed before me on the 7th June, 2001 at 9. 30 a.m. when this application will be mentioned for further directions. Mr Okello is also asked to get in touch with the Principal State Counsel Nyeri so that he can deal with this application appropriately when it is called out before the Judge on that 12. 6.2001. It is so ordered.
A.G.A. ETYANG’
JUDGE
4. 6.2001
